FDA Licenses First Freeze-Dried Plasma Product

Ezplaz can be stored at room temperature and reconstituted in about a minute, giving providers a backup when conventional plasma is unavailable.

  • On Wednesday, the Food and Drug Administration approved Ezplaz Freeze Dried Plasma, the first freeze-dried plasma product in the United States. The agency granted a biologics license to Vascular Solutions, a subsidiary of Teleflex, for adult patients requiring transfusions when conventional products are unavailable.
  • Packaged in plastic to prevent breakage, Ezplaz is designed for disaster response, rural care, and combat settings. It is available in Group AB and Group A low-titer blood types, enabling immediate use before a patient's blood type is known.
  • The approval arrives as the American Red Cross grapples with a national blood supply crisis, with donations at a four-year summer low. Dr. Pampee Young, the organization's chief medical officer, told Reuters the product is "unlikely by itself to materially alleviate the blood-component shortages hospitals experience most frequently."
  • Separately, the FDA approved a new over-the-counter Tylenol formulation combining acetaminophen and naproxen sodium. Manufacturer Kenvue stated the tablet works within 30 minutes and offers pain relief for up to 12 hours.
  • This approval comes despite President Donald Trump and Health and Human Services Secretary Robert F. Kennedy Jr. claiming Tylenol poses pregnancy risks. Medical groups dispute these claims, citing lack of backing from the full body of scientific evidence.
